From 9365047aba7ff624508b4475b6fc3e523d419057 Mon Sep 17 00:00:00 2001 From: Tom Tromey Date: Wed, 20 Jul 2005 23:39:44 +0000 Subject: sources.am, [...]: Rebuilt. * sources.am, Makefile.in: Rebuilt. * Makefile.am (all_xlib_lo_files): Removed. (all_libgcj_lo_files): Likewise. (lib_gnu_awt_xlib_la_LIBADD): List correct .lo files. (xlib_java_source_files): Removed. (xlib_nat_headers): Updated. * configure: Rebuilt. * configure.ac: Create standard.omit. * standard.omit.in: New file. * standard.omit: Removed. * scripts/makemake.tcl (gnu/gcj/xlib, gnu/awt/xlib): Now 'package'. (emit_package_rule): Special case xlib peers. (emit_source_var): Likewise. Read standard.omit.in. * gnu/awt/xlib/XToolkit.java (createEmbeddedWindow): New method. From-SVN: r102211 --- libjava/configure.ac | 19 +++++++++++++------ 1 file changed, 13 insertions(+), 6 deletions(-) (limited to 'libjava/configure.ac') diff --git a/libjava/configure.ac b/libjava/configure.ac index ff45f6e..2f9f508 100644 --- a/libjava/configure.ac +++ b/libjava/configure.ac @@ -175,12 +175,10 @@ for peer in $peerlibs ; do echo "*** xlib peers requested but no X library available" 1>&2 exit 1 else - # This code has bit-rotted a bit. - echo "*** xlib peers can't currently be compiled -- disabling" 1>&2 -# use_xlib_awt="yes" -# if test -z "$TOOLKIT"; then -# TOOLKIT=gnu.awt.xlib.XToolkit -# fi + use_xlib_awt="yes" + if test -z "$TOOLKIT"; then + TOOLKIT=gnu.awt.xlib.XToolkit + fi fi ;; gtk) @@ -208,6 +206,15 @@ done AM_CONDITIONAL(XLIB_AWT, test "$use_xlib_awt" = yes) AM_CONDITIONAL(GTK_AWT, test "$use_gtk_awt" = yes) +# Create standard.omit based on decisions we just made. +cp $srcdir/standard.omit.in standard.omit +if test "$use_xlib_awt" != yes; then + echo gnu/awt/xlib >> standard.omit + echo gnu/gcj/xlib >> standard.omit +fi +if test "$use_gtk_awt" != yes; then + echo gnu/java/awt/peer/gtk >> standard.omit +fi if test -z "${with_multisubdir}"; then builddotdot=. -- cgit v1.1